Lockheed Martin Corp's dividend schedule

Lockheed Martin Corp has paid quarterly across the 64 years of records we hold, with the most recent ex-date on September 1, 2026. Its ex-dates usually land in the middle of the month.

Payment follows the ex-date by about 28 days, based on the announcements we hold for LMT.

Increases have a season: of the 24 raises in our record, most take effect with the November payment, so that is the ex-date to watch for a change in the amount. The most recent was 4.5%, effective with the December 2025 ex-date.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need to own LMT before the ex-dividend date?
Yes. You must already hold the shares when trading opens on the ex-dividend date to receive the payment. Buying on the ex-date itself is too late — the seller keeps that dividend. See ex-date vs record date vs payment date for how the dates fit together.
